Aging forests emit carbon老齡化森林成為“碳源”

美國農業部的一份新報告稱,美國森林碳儲量持續增長,森林在未來可能會加劇全球變暖,而非緩解全球變暖,到2070年,美國的森林大部分可能轉化為“主要碳源”。

1 According to a new USDA (the US Department ofAgriculture) report, US forests could worsen globalwarming because they are being destroyed by naturaldisasters and are losing their ability to absorbplanet?warming gases as they get older. The reportpredicts that the ability of forests to absorb carbonwill start declining after 2025 and that forests couldrelease up to 100 million metric tons of carbon a yearas their emissions from decaying (腐爛) trees go above their carbon absorption. Forestscould become a“ substantial carbon source” by 2070, the USDA report says.

2 The loss of carbon absorption is driven in part by natural disasters such as wildfire,tornadoes and hurricanes, which are increasing in frequency and strength as globaltemperatures rise. The disasters destroy forestland, destroying its ecosystem anddecreasing its ability to absorb carbon, according to Lynn Riley, a senior manager ofclimate science at the American Forest Foundation. Aging forests also contribute. Thereport finds that older mature trees absorb less carbon than younger trees of the samespecies, and US forests are rapidly aging.

3 This trend is likely to continue, as forests come under increasing threat from climatechange and exploitation (開采). The typical tropical forest may become a carbon sourceby the 2060s, according to Simon Lewis, a professor in the school of geography atUniversity of Leeds“. Humans have been lucky so far, as tropical forests are cleaning uplots of our pollution, but they can't keep doing that indefinitely,” he said“. We need to cutdown fossil fuel emissions before the global carbon cycle starts working against us.”

4 US forests currently absorb 11 percent of US carbon emissions, or 150 million metrictons of carbon a year, equal to the combined emissions from 40 coal power plants, accordingto the report. The loss of forests as natural carbon absorbers will require the USto cut emissions more rapidly to reach net zero.“ As we work to decarbonize (脫碳), forestsare one of the greatest tools. If we were to lose that tool, it means we will contributethat much more in emissions,” Riley said.
